1. Clean Burning Technology:

One of the biggest concerns with wood stoves is their impact on air quality. Traditional wood stoves emit harmful pollutants such as carbon monoxide, nitrogen oxides, and particulate matter. But with the development of clean-burning technology, this is no longer a problem. Clean-burning wood stoves use advanced combustion techniques to reduce emissions significantly, making them more environmentally friendly.

2. EPA-Certified Stoves:

In addition to clean burning technology, the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) has also introduced regulations for wood stoves to reduce their impact on air quality. EPA-certified stoves must meet strict emission standards and are tested for efficiency and safety. This certification ensures that the wood stove you choose is not only environmentally friendly but also meets high standards of performance.

3. Automated Air Control: 

Controlling the airflow in a wood stove is crucial for maintaining an efficient and safe fire. Traditional stoves required manual adjustment of the air vents, which could be challenging to get right. But with automated air control, the stove does this for you. Sensors detect the temperature and adjust the air intake accordingly, ensuring a steady and consistent burn without any guesswork.

4. Advanced Heat Distribution:

One common issue with wood stoves is that they tend to heat only the immediate area where they are installed, leaving other rooms in the house cold. To combat this, manufacturers have developed advanced heat distribution systems such as built-in fans and ducting, which help distribute the heat evenly throughout your home.

5. High-Efficiency Stoves:

Not all wood stoves are created equal when it comes to efficiency. High-efficiency stoves use advanced designs and materials that allow for more complete combustion, resulting in less waste and more heat output. These stoves can reach efficiency levels of up to 80%, making them a cost-effective heating option for your home.

7. Eco-Friendly Options:

With the increasing focus on sustainability, many homeowners are looking for eco-friendly heating solutions. Wood stoves have evolved to meet this demand with the introduction of pellet stoves and gasification technology. Pellet stoves use compressed wood pellets as fuel, which are a renewable energy source, while gasification technology allows for more complete combustion, resulting in fewer emissions.

8. Smart Stove Technology:

The rise of smart home technology has also made its way to wood stoves. With the use of wifi or Bluetooth, you can now control your wood stove remotely. This feature allows you to adjust the temperature, monitor performance, and receive alerts, all from your smartphone or tablet.
